What Staying Invisible Costs

37%of nonprofits ran a deficit
20¢of the median grant dollar covers operations
1 in 10proposals accepted
15 to 100+hours per application

Foundations dedicate a median of just 20% of grant dollars to general operating support, the money that pays for data, evaluation, and reporting.

Sources: Nonprofit Finance Fund State of the Nonprofit Sector Survey (2025); Stanford Social Innovation Review; FreeWill (2025); GrantStation State of Grantseeking.

The Problem

Stop Searching For Proof
Every Time A Deadline Hits

The work happens every day. But the proof lives in spreadsheets, inboxes, and memory, in exactly the organizations with the least capacity to pull it together. So when a funder asks what you can show, the mission waits while your team digs.

And the bar keeps rising. Funders want documented outcomes, data capacity, and past performance you can back up. Luminary reads only the sources you approve, keeps a live inventory of your records, and surfaces the evidence for each control, so the answer is ready before the deadline is.
